Extended Description

ECLK430 Eaton Crouse-Hinds: Eaton Crouse-Hinds series ECLK coupling, 30" flexible length, Male connection one end, female connection one end, Forged brass, 1-1/4" trade size
Product Name
Eaton Crouse-Hinds series ECLK coupling
Catalog Number
ECLK430
Product Length/Depth
35.75 in
Product Height
2.94 in
Product Width
2.94 in
Product Weight
12 lb
UPC
782274263007
Area classification
Hazardous/Classified Locations
Standards type
NEC/CEC
NEC hazardous rating
Class I, Division 1 Class II, Division 1 Class III
Gender
Male connection one end, female connection one end
Flexible length
30"
Trade size
1-1/4"
Material
Forged brass
